Job description

Job Title: Talent Development Coordinator

About Us

At West Cancer Center, we are dedicated to providing compassionate, patient-centered care while advancing groundbreaking research. Our team fosters collaboration, innovation, and professional growth, ensuring that every role contributes to making a difference in patients’ lives. Join us in our mission to provide comprehensive support to those navigating the challenges of cancer treatment.

Position Overview

The Talent Development Coordinator supports the learning and development efforts of West Cancer Center by managing logistics, coordinating onboarding processes, maintaining training systems, and contributing to program design and project execution. This role is instrumental in helping build a learning culture that supports both individual and organizational growth.

Key Responsibilities
  • Coordinate logistics for learning and development programs, events, and instructor-led trainings (ILT)
  • Manage Learning Management System (LMS) tickets and assist with issue resolution
  • Track and monitor training compliance and completion for regulatory and internal requirements
  • Schedule training sessions, workshops, and certifications
  • Assist in creating and maintaining training materials and content
  • Oversee onboarding tracking for new employees and student onboarding for internships/externships
  • Maintain training records in LMS and compile reports on training participation and progress
  • Manage training calendars and registration for upcoming courses and workshops
  • Assist with budget administration for educational programs
  • Partner with Human Resources on broader organizational initiatives and learning strategies
  • Maintain training resources and communication on the intranet
  • Perform other duties as needed to support Talent Development initiatives
Qualifications
Education & Experience
  • Two-year college degree in a related field with 6+ years of experience in Learning & Development, Training, HR, or a similar role
  • Experience with LMS platforms (e.g., Absorb, Cornerstone)
  • Knowledge of SCORM standards and e-learning best practices
  • Familiarity with training administration and compliance tracking
  • Basic experience in instructional design
  • Bilingual skills a plus
Skills & Abilities
  • Proficiency in LMS administration, troubleshooting, and reporting
  • Strong knowledge of training and development principles and project management
  • Skilled in Microsoft Office (PowerPoint, Word, Excel)
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• High level of professionalism and discretion in handling sensitive information
  • Strong organizational and time management abilities
  • Self-starter with the ability to work both independently and collaboratively
